From the first sprint to a living operating model

A sprint gets you running. The same visible process and improvement channel keep the system evolving with the business.

Working system

  1. 1

    Map the process

    Start from how work should run. Guided mapping, workshops and resources are available.

  2. 2

    Expert review

    Tevind checks feasibility, bounds the release, and clarifies the specification before mutual acceptance.

  3. 3

    Build in the Forge

    Controlled generators, review, and automated plus manual tests turn the map into a robust custom system—typically in days after approved scope, not months.

  4. 4

    Deploy and improve

    The visual representation and built-in request path stay live, so you can improve and redeploy as operations change.

Example

How project work runs in the system

Exact contractual requirements, standards and permissions must be scoped with the customer.

Project work happens in interfaces shaped for each role—on site and at the desk—so deviations and daily reports are entered where the work happens. Automations handle every repeatable step in the process. Reports and invoicing support are outputs of that work, not something compiled afterward.

  • Role-based views (phone + desk)
  • Work done in the system
  • Automate repeatable process steps
  • External data (API / MCP)
  • Deviations & daily reports
  • Roles and permissions

Role-specific surfaces

Project manager

A desk view for follow-up: see what is complete, what is missing, and what needs attention—while the project is still running, not when invoicing starts.

Employee / subcontractor

A work interface built for their role—only the steps, fields and checks their job requires—on phone or tablet where the work happens.

Client / reviewer

A reviewer portal with searchable records and clear overviews—optional AI-assisted summaries when enabled—reflecting the latest registered work, not a file chase.

When a requirement is added

  1. A project manager needs photos on selected deviation types.
  2. Tevind (or the PM) updates the process map and adjusts the forms people use.
  3. The changes are quickly developed. Dependencies and risks are easily evaluated and tested as the system description stays fresh.
  4. The PM approves the change against the updated map.
  5. The new version is deployed and the map describing the system stays up-to-date for future changes.

Sprint pricing

A bounded first release, built to evolve.

  • Free initial consultation call.
  • Process workshop included when needed.
  • Sprint the first version and early implementations to start the digitization journey.
  • Continuous development in the new system.

Scope assessment before acceptance; Tevind may decline or propose a different scope.

Currency

Process Sprint

EUR 13,000–18,000

One bounded process, from map to first usable version, suitable for limited projects that need its own system.

System Sprint

EUR 30,000–41,000

A broader long term operational business system with more roles, automation, custom interfaces and integrations.

Forward Engineer Deployment

Tailored Quotation

We send a forward engineer to your company to drive through the changes on site—including training and hands-on rollout support.

Continuous improvement package

from EUR 900/month*

Ensure smooth operations and a long term commitment to digitized operations.

*subject to hosting plan

Prices excl. VAT. Payment 50% before start, 50% at delivery.

  • OVHCloud VPS hosting setup included; hosting time and continuous improvement are separate; domain name costs are not included.
  • Data migration is not included in the sprint price, but basic API-import structures are.
  • Delivery target depends on approved scope and complexity.
  • Special requirements outside the map structure are subject to separate pricing.

Ownership and flexibility

Designed to keep you in power of your system.

You retain

  • Your business data
  • Generated application source code and repository access.
  • Process canvas and specifications
  • Ability to self-host or use another qualified supplier
  • A functioning system if recurring service ends, subject to taking charge of hosting.

Tevind keeps

  • Its generators and internal platform
  • Continued repository/system access while providing agreed service
  • Right to reuse source code (not company data)

Frequently asked questions

What makes Tevind better than alternative solutions?

With our build model, we deliver faster and at lower cost—with long-term maintenance and development built into the plan from the start.

What can be built in a sprint?

A bounded first usable release of operational software for an agreed process—forms, roles, permissions, reporting and agreed automation or integrations within the sprint limits.

Is the sprint timeframe target guaranteed?

No. It is a normal target after approved scope and material. Complexity, missing inputs or expanded requirements can change timing.

Do we need to know exactly how the process should work?

You need a clear operational intent. Tevind helps refine feasibility and scope; a workshop can be included when needed.

Do we need a complete ERP system?

Many customers start with one process, integrate with existing tools, or grow toward a broader operational system over time. However, we can help you implement ERPNext for a full ERP system within the Tevind platform.

Can Tevind integrate with our existing software?

Yes, when integrations are scoped. Typically through API. Integration effort depends on the systems involved and is agreed before the sprint starts.

Who owns the data and code?

The customer keeps its data and receives the generated application source code and repository. Tevind's generators are not transferred.

What happens if we stop the recurring service?

You keep a functioning system subject to taking over hosting and operations. Handover terms are defined in the service agreement.

Does AI access our documents or database?

Not by default for live business data. AI may be used in development under controlled settings; customer records can be withheld.

Where is the system hosted?

Tevind-operated servers are within the EU by OVHCloud. Self-hosting is also possible.

What framework do you use?

We use Frappe Framework, an established open-source framework with MIT license as base.; On top of that we have built a custom framework to fit our needs.

Does Tevind guarantee compliance with a regulation or contract?

No. Specific regulatory or contractual requirements must be explicitly scoped. Tevind does not claim automatic compliance.

What is excluded from the fixed sprint price?

Data migration, ongoing hosting, larger out-of-scope changes, and work beyond the agreed sprint boundaries.

What happens when a project does not fit the sprint scope?

Tevind may decline, propose a different scope, or recommend a phased approach after the qualification call and scope assessment.
